About Me
I came to massage therapy through medicine. My original path was toward becoming a physician — I wanted to help people heal. Massage became my first real connection to that dream: the ability to place my hands on someone and feel what they came to see me for. That palpation skill — sensing inside the tissue — became my foundation and my obsession. I graduated from The Pennsylvania School of Muscle Therapy in 1996 — the original independent school in King of Prussia, since absorbed into the Cortiva Institute chain — and have been in practice ever since.
I launched Hands on Healing Concepts, studied Alternative Medicine at West Chester University, and in October 2001 opened Optimal Massage — growing it into a 24-person practice of massage therapists, Reiki practitioners, Yoga and Tai Chi instructors. I completed advanced certification in Pfrimmer Deep Muscle Therapy, Clinical Orthopedic Manual Therapy, Sports Massage, and Hydrotherapy, and traveled and taught with my mentor Dr. Joe Muscolino across the US and to Indonesia.
